Purpose and Operation

 

The principal objects of the National Measurement Act 1960 (the Act) are to:

  • establish a national system of units and standards of measurement of physical quantities;
  • provide for the uniform use of those uniform units and standards of measurement throughout Australia;
  • co-ordinate the operation of the national system of measurement; and
  • provide the legal framework for a national system of trade measurement.

The Act and the National Measurement Regulations 1999 (the Regulations) prescribe SI (International System of Units) base units of measurement and Australian legal units of measurement. They also prescribe certain additional, non-SI, legal units of measurement that may be used for particular purposes.

The purpose of the National Measurement Guidelines 2026 (the Guidelines) is to support the national measurement system by prescribing a uniform system to express Australian legal units of measurement to ensure a common and consistent understanding of measurement units used in Australia and to align the expression of measurement units in Australia with internationally accepted practice.

Authority

Section 7B of the Act provides that the Chief Metrologist may make guidelines governing the way in which Australian legal units of measurement may be combined to produce Australian legal units of measurement, and the way in which Australian legal units of measurement may be combined with a prefix for the purposes of subsection 7A(3) of the Act.

Consultation

The National Measurement Institute undertook a public consultation from 24 November to 25 December 2025 to inform the remaking of the 2026 Guidelines. The consultation was targeted towards stakeholders who currently reference the existing National Measurement Guidelines 2016, including government agencies, measurement laboratories, and industry bodies. Three submissions were received, each of which supported the proposed changes to the Guidelines.

Section 7 – Physical quantities

Section 7 makes clear that Australian legal units of measurement may be formed only for the physical quantities prescribed under the National Measurement Regulations 1999 (the Regulations). These are set out in Schedules 1 and 2 of the Regulations.  

Section 8 – Combining Australian legal units of measurement

This section provides that if a physical quantity is formed by combining two or more physical quantities then the Australian legal unit of measurement used to describe the combined physical quantity would reflect the mathematical relations linking the corresponding physical quantities.

The section also provides that the resulting Australian legal unit of measurement may be then represented by either a name or symbol that is itself derived from an Australian legal unit of measurement. For example the Australian legal unit of measurement of pascal can either be represented as Pa or N/m2. See Schedules 1 and 2 to the Regulations for the list of names and symbols of Australian legal units of measurement.

Section 9 – Combining Australian legal units of measurement and SI prefix

This section provides that a decimal multiple or submultiple of an Australian legal unit of measurement other than a kilogram must be formed using a single SI prefix. This is because kilogram already contains a prefix (kilo) as part of its name.

The note to subsection (1) is an example how a decimal multiple or submultiple of an Australian legal unit of measurement is to be expressed.

The note to subsection (2) makes clear that kilogram is a SI base unit of measurement as prescribed by Schedule 1 to the Regulations.

Subsection (3) of section 9 provides that an additional derived unit of measurement, as listed under part 4 of Schedule 1 to the Regulations, may also be combined with another Australian legal unit of measurement to form an Australian legal unit of measurement. For example the amount of gram per mole unit may be represented as grams/mol.

In addition, this section provides that an Australian legal unit of measurement and a SI prefix may be combined with other Australian legal units of measurement symbols, as listed under Schedules 1 and 2 to the Regulations, to form a symbol for a compound unit that is an Australian legal unit of measurement. For example the Australian legal unit measurement of metre (m) with the prefix of kilo (k) can be combined with the non-SI unit of time (hour), represented with the symbol (h), to form km/h for a measurement of speed.  

Section 10 – Australian legal units of measurement that must not be combined with prefixes

Section 10 sets out a list of Australian legal units of measurement which must not be combined with SI prefixes so as to avoid confusion. Further, any decimal multiple or submultiple of kilogram must be formed by attaching a prefix to gram as kilogram already contains a prefix.

The note under subsection (2) makes clear that for historical reasons, kilogram already contains a prefix.

Section 11 – Australian legal units of measurement that may only be combined with prefixes that form multiples of the unit

This section clarifies that the Australian legal units of measurement of tonne may only be combined with an SI prefix that gives a decimal multiple of tonne. The note to this section provides an example that kilotonne is acceptable but not millitonne. This is because millitonne is a decimal sub-multiple of a tonne.

Section 12 –Expression of Australian legal units of measurement

This section sets out requirements for expressing Australian legal units of measurement. The purpose of this is to align the expression of measurement units in Australia with internationally accepted practice.

Subsection (1) makes clear that the names and symbols of Australian legal units of measurement must not be used together in the same expression. The note underneath gives the example that km/h is acceptable but not kilometre/h.

Subsection (2) makes clear that an adjective or sign must not be added to the name or symbol of an Australian legal unit of measurement. The note underneath gives the example that Wa cannot be used as a unit for acoustic power.

Subsection (3) makes clear that the symbol for an SI Prefix must be placed immediately before the symbol for the Australian legal unit of measurement without an intermediate space. The note underneath gives examples of how this should operate including km for kilometre and MJ for megajoule.

Subsection (4) makes clear that for a decimal or multiple or submultiple of an Australian unit of measurement that is expressed as a fraction, an SI Prefix may precede the Australian legal unit of measurement in the numerator, or the denominator, or both if there is no other way to form an unambiguous expression, and should precede the Australian legal unit of measurement in the numerator. The note to this subsection provides examples of how this works in practice.

Subsection (5) provides that only a single SI Prefix may be used to form a multiple of a derived Australian legal unit of measurement.

Subsection (6) lists the symbols that may be used as a product symbol. These are a dot (·), a full stop (.) if the resulting expression is unambiguous, or a space where the Australian legal unit of measurement is not the same as the SI prefix. The note to the subsection provides an example of how the product symbols should be used.

Subsection (7) provides that the product symbol can only be used with symbols representing Australian legal units of measurement. The example below this subsection states that N·m is acceptable, but Newton·metre is not.

Subsection (8) provides that an Australian legal unit of measurement derived from the division of 2 other Australian legal units of measurement may be expressed using an oblique stroke (/), horizontal line (-) or negative exponent (-x). The note to this subsection provides examples of each of these expressions.

Subsection (9) makes clear that the oblique stroke (/) must not be repeated on a line unless parentheses are also used to avoid ambiguity. For complex expressions, however, negative exponents or parentheses must be used.

Subsection (10) specifies that a space must be left after the numerical value of an Australian legal unit of measurement and before the name or symbol of the unit of measurement.

Subsection (11) creates an exception to subsection (10). Subsection 12(10) of these Guidelines do not apply when expressing the numerical values and the symbols for degrees, minutes and seconds of either (a) geographic coordinates, or (b) plane angles.
